The “Wicked” star, Ariana Grande, walked the Red Oscar carpet on Sunday in a sculptural pink top and a tulle skirt of Schiaparelli, one of the various actors to make bold fashion statements.

Whoopi Goldberg wore a shiny blue dress with a flared skirt, while British actress Yasmin Finney wore a black dress with pencase accessories that shot her head.

The “A Complete Unknown” star, Elle Fanning, chose a white lace dress with a complete skirt and a black belt, while the nominated for the best support actress “The Brutalist”, Felicity Jones, wore a silver dress with clefts and a tie around the waist.

Demi Moore, favored to win the best actress of “The Sustance”, won a bright silver dress with a train behind her.

Zoe Saldana, a favorite to win the best support actress for his turn in “Emilia Pérez”, wore a several level brown dress with a bright lid and long gloves in his arms.

The best actress nominated for “A complete stranger”, Monica Barbaro, won a voluminous high waist skirt with a bright top.
Halle Berry wore a silver dress without braces with small bright tiles running down the dress, while Gal Gadot chose a shiny red dress with a complete skirt.

Among men, the black tuxedo was popular and the host of the Oscar Conan O'Brien looked one. But Jeff Goldblum picked up a white jacket and a floral purple shirt with purple flowers together with his flap.

The best “A Complete” actor, Timothee Chalamet, chose a lemon yellow suit and shirt.

Colman Domingo, nominated for the best actor to “Sing Sing”, expanded his look with a bright red jacket and a black shirt and flaps to go with black pants.

The comedian Bowen Yang wore a pink shirt and an embroidered leather jacket without a tie.

The creators behind the animated film “Wallace & Gromit: Vengeance Most Fowl” brought accessories related to their film, and one of the directors of the documentary about Ukraine, “War Porcelana”, led a small dog in his arms.
